Link Building Strategies

Link building secures hyperlinks from external websites to strengthen a roofing site’s authority and organic visibility. When executed correctly it can improve search rankings and attract higher‑quality leads. Key tactics for roofers include:

  1. Content Marketing: Produce useful content—blog posts, infographics, short videos—that earns backlinks.
  2. Networking with Local Businesses: Partner with complementary local businesses (hardware stores, remodelers) for mutual references and links.
  3. Customer Reviews: Encourage reviews on platforms like Google My Business and local directories to boost credibility and referral opportunities.

Applied consistently, these tactics increase domain authority and organic lead volume.

Traditional Marketing Strategies

Traditional marketing remains valuable for local customer acquisition and face‑to‑face engagement. Common methods include:

  1. Direct Mail Campaigns: Postcards or flyers targeted to neighbourhoods—especially after storms—can drive inquiries.
  2. Local Advertising: Community newspapers, local radio, and sponsorships reach nearby homeowners.
  3. Networking Events: Trade shows and local events build trust through personal connections.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the key differences between link building and traditional marketing for roofers?

Link building strengthens a roofing site’s online authority through backlinks, improving search rankings and visibility. Traditional marketing focuses on direct local engagement via mail and community events, building personal relationships and trust. Both are important in a complete marketing programme.

How can roofers effectively integrate link building with traditional marketing?

Integrate by producing high‑value content that serves both online and offline audiences. Publish a roofing guide online and print brochures for local distribution; include website URLs or QR codes on printed materials to drive traffic to online resources.

What role does local SEO play in the marketing strategies for roofing companies?

Local SEO optimises a company’s presence for local searches. Use location keywords, keep Google My Business updated and gather reviews to improve visibility and conversions.

How can customer reviews impact a roofing company's marketing efforts?

Reviews act as social proof and influence potential clients’ decisions. Display testimonials on the company website and social profiles, and encourage customers to leave reviews on Google My Business to boost local SEO and reputation.
